Summary of Position:

The Training Coordinator is responsible for developing and delivering unique internal training courses and programs for business units within tk Materials as well as coordinates employee participation in outside training programs. Duties include interaction with Subject Matter Experts, management, and HR to determine training needs, implementing training programs and reviewing feedback from previous training programs to determine success and improvement opportunities.

Key Accountabilities:

Conduct organization-wide training needs assessments to identify skill and or knowledge gaps that need training as well as aid in prioritizing the list.

Work with SMEs to design and develop training programs and content

Where applicable, manage outside resources training content creation

Learn training methods and techniques, use learning to prepare and coordinate training sessions.

Assist management in developing annual training plans by function and employee, providing scheduling as well as training record recording support as needed.

Work with Learning Management System (LMS) Administrator to structure and maintain a training curriculum database and assisting others on the use of the system.

Help determine training methods or activities (e.g., video, classroom, on-the-job training, at vendor, professional development classes, etc.).

Market company training opportunities to employees, encouraging participation by providing information on benefits of training curriculum.

Work with company managers to create training schedules for company departments.

Inform employees on scheduled training events.

Coordinate training activities logistics

Deliver training content as needed

Gather and evaluate feedback from employees and management on training results to identify weaknesses and areas that need additional training.

Help identify and evaluate storage / retrieval / record keeping methods and software for the training program (within tk or with external vendor).

Manage the training budget.
